The causes of this disease are also very complicated. There are two specific ones: The first reason is the theory of parthenogenesis, which mainly refers to the fact that the primordial germ cells of patients with ovarian teratoma are severely stimulated, resulting in atypical division, thus causing parthenogenesis. This is the main cause of ovarian teratoma. Every woman should pay attention to changes in her body at all times, and it is best to avoid this cause of the disease. Another reason is the single-cell theory. Relevant clinical studies have found that ovarian teratomas mainly come from the pre-embryonic stage. Primitive abnormal reactions will occur at this stage. These embryos have strong decomposition characteristics, and the remaining universal cells will grow irregularly. The development of the embryo is also in an abnormal state, and finally it will be completely separated from the whole. The decomposition will be chaotic, the proliferation will increase significantly, and teratoma will form over a long period of time.
